Who has never heard of the Cave Canem ? This inscription, 2000 years old, was used in Roman times to warn some ill-intentioned person about to enter the owner's dwelling.
Did you know that this depiction of man's best friend and guardian is not the only specimen to be seen in the ruins of Pompeii ? There are actually two other major mosaics in the Naples (Napoli) region. One is still showing a big dog on a leash (at house of Paquio Proculus). Finally, one can observe another dog in the House of Orpheus, but it depicts a docile dog.
